It has been scientifically proven that every cell in our body has a type of vital time titled telomere. This set tells the cell when to stop dividing. If a cell is unable to reproduce then new cells are not born, hence our body dies. This is styled ageing. The scientists today are trying to edit the genes thus instructing cells to make longer telomere or beyond spirit the concept of telomere which can result in indefinite life span.
